2. Converting Ounces to Pounds



The given weight is 166 lb 4 oz. We must first convert the ounces to pounds. There are 16 ounces in 1 pound. Therefore, we divide the ounces by 16:

4 oz / 16 oz/lb = 0.25 lb

This means 4 ounces are equivalent to 0.25 pounds. Adding this to the existing 166 pounds, we get a total weight of 166.25 lb.

3. The Conversion Factor: Pounds to Kilograms



The crucial step is understanding the conversion factor between pounds and kilograms. 1 kilogram is approximately equal to 2.20462 pounds. This factor is used to convert pounds to kilograms.

4. Calculating the Kilograms: Step-by-Step



Now, we can perform the conversion:

Step 1: Identify the weight in pounds: 166.25 lb
Step 2: Use the conversion factor: 1 kg ≈ 2.20462 lb
Step 3: Perform the calculation: 166.25 lb / 2.20462 lb/kg ≈ 75.40 kg

Therefore, 166 lb 4 oz is approximately equal to 75.40 kg. It's important to note that this is an approximation due to rounding the conversion factor. Using a more precise conversion factor will yield a slightly different result, but the difference will generally be negligible for most practical purposes.

5. Dealing with Significant Figures



The accuracy of the final answer depends on the number of significant figures used. The given weight (166 lb 4 oz) implies a certain level of precision. Using a more precise conversion factor (e.g., 2.20462262) may result in more decimal places in the final answer, but this increased precision may not be justified by the initial measurement's accuracy. In most scenarios, rounding to two decimal places (75.40 kg) is sufficient.

5. Why is it important to understand the difference between mass and weight? While often used interchangeably, mass is the amount of matter in an object, while weight is the force of gravity on that mass. The conversion between pounds and kilograms is primarily a conversion of mass, although the weight will also change proportionally due to gravity. In most everyday situations, this distinction is not critical, but in physics and certain engineering applications, it's essential.
